The design of position control structure of milling head spindle based on servo electric cylinder drive

  • Aiming at the shortage of the retracting movement of the main shaft of the sliding part milling head of the common part of the combined machine tool, a structural scheme of the retracting movement of the main shaft driven by the servo electric cylinder is designed. The milling head spindle is extended and retracted into a linear reciprocating motion. The hydraulic cylinder drive is converted into a servo electric cylinder push rod drive. The spindle extension position is stepless and precise control, and has the functions of automatic rough milling, semi-finishing milling, finishing milling and allowing the knife. Flexible machining on CNC combined milling machines has been widely used.
